481 4th St is a multi family building located at 481 4th St in Brooklyn. It was built in 1920. The structure rises 3 stories and contains 2 units.


481 4th St is located within Park Slope.

Park Slope
Scenic sidewalks and fun for all ages. Park Slope is a name-brand Brooklyn neighborhood known for its organic food markets and picturesque, pedestrian-friendly sidewalks. Prospect Park, charming cafes, and plenty of public amenities contribute to the neighborhood's small-town vibe.
